A sailboat’s sail has three sides that are all the same length. Each side measures x−10 units. The sail’s perimeter is 63 units.

Answer:

  • x = 31

Step-by-step explanation:

  • Triangle with same sides given.
  • Each side = x - 10 units

Perimeter is the sum of the side lengths.

<u>Substitute and solve for x:</u>

  • 3(x - 10) = 63
  • x - 10 = 21
  • x = 31
